Designed for top sportswomen, the Women's Ski Pants Reserve 2L Stretch Slim Pants Washed Lavender women's ski trousers Burton East are technical, versatile and insulated, combining a Fitted cut with optimum protection.
Manufactured from stretchy DRYRIDE™ 2-layer 100% recycled polyester fabric, it keeps you dry and comfortable in all conditions thanks to its exceptional waterproofing and breathability . Welded seams and PFAS-free Water-repellent treatment provide an impenetrable barrier against the elements. In addition, its dedicated environmental policy is reflected in its use of certified materials. bluesign®. These Pants have been designed for comfort and performance. The Fitted cut ensures unrestricted range of movement, while Mesh-lined ventilation on the inner thighs provides effective temperature regulation.
These functional trousers feature a microfleece-lined waistband and fly for added warmth, an integrated key ring in the pocket and several zipped pockets, including a secret pocket inside a hand warmer. A range of adjustment options, such as the Belt adjustment system at Velcro and the hem liftsystem, guarantee a perfect fit. Materials:
- Main materials: 100% recycled Polyester stretch canvas weave
- Membrane: DRYRIDE™ 2L
- Lining: 100% Nylon taffeta
- Stretch Yoke/Insert : 85% Nylon, 15% Elastane
